How they compare

Lithuania currently reports 701,205 units per square kilometre against 676,303 units per square kilometre in Kyrgyzstan, a difference of 24,902 units per square kilometre.

Across all 14 years both countries report, Lithuania has been ahead every year.

Kyrgyzstan ranks 120th and Lithuania ranks 118th of 159 countries.

Lithuania has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
